23f426d586c1868724ba519ee214169e812710dce75e388e0bdc030b7f029a6e

771119 (817 blocks ago)

148755139

⏴ Block 771118 (abffdd6f...904) | Block 771120 ⏵ | Latest block ⏭

Metadata

2/5/25, 1:50 pm UTC (1d 3:14:18 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.9048 SENT

Transactions (0)

Show raw details